Causes of orthodontic problems

 |
"What causes orthodontic problems?"
|
| |
Most
orthodontic problems are inherited, including tooth size and jaw size, and may lead to crowding of teeth or spacing of teeth. Overbites, underbites,
extra or missing teeth, and irregularities of the jaws, teeth, and
face also are inherited. Other orthodontic problems can be caused
from accidents, pacifier or thumb sucking, dental disease, or the
premature loss of either the primary or permanent teeth.

"What habits contribute to
"bad bites? " |
| |
A number of
childhood habits can lead to orthodontic problems, such as thumb or
finger sucking, sucking on a pacifier, sucking on a lip, mouth
breathing (often caused by enlarged tonsils and adenoids),
fingernail biting, and "tongue thrust".
